Property Details for 1 Short St, Cape Paterson

1 Short St, Cape Paterson is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House and was built in 1989. The property has a land size of 510m2 and floor size of 124m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in January 2021.

Last Listing description (January 2022)

With a huge outdoor decked area extending from family room, this beach house is ready for families to enjoy summer gatherings.
Slate floors flow throughout living areas with split system, ceiling fans and wood paneled walls. Kitchen has electric oven, cook top and Blanco dishwasher.
The Master bedroom has walk in robe with ensuite and sliding door access to deck, and another two bedrooms, one also with deck access.

The bathroom has shower with separate WC and laundry.
Privacy screens frame the deck with wood fire pit area, built in BBQ and with native gardens at rear.
A great beach house for indoor outdoor living.

About Cape Paterson 3995

The size of Cape Paterson is approximately 16.1 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 0.9% of total area. The population of Cape Paterson in 2011 was 718 people. By 2016 the population was 892 showing a population growth of 24.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cape Paterson is 60-69 years. Households in Cape Paterson are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cape Paterson work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 68.1% of the homes in Cape Paterson were owner-occupied compared with 68.6% in 2016.

Cape Paterson has 1,500 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Cape Paterson have seen a 46.95%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 43.04%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Cape Paterson is $735,983 while the median value for Units is $580,673.
  • Houses have a median rent of $475 while Units have a median rent of $305.
